Cooling device |
摘要 |
A cooling device for a charger capable of simplifying the device configuration and reducing the power consumption is provided. Cooling device for cooling the charger for charging a battery with use of power supply received from a power source includes a compressor for circulating a cooling agent, a condenser for condensing the cooling agent, a decompressor for decompressing the cooling agent condensed by condenser, an evaporator for evaporating the cooling agent decompressed by the decompressor, and a cooling portion for cooling the charger with use of the cooling agent flowing from the condenser, and the cooling portion is provided on a path of the cooling agent flowing from the condenser to the evaporator. |

主权项 |
1. A cooling device for cooling a charger for charging a battery with use of power supply received from a power source, comprising:
a compressor for circulating a cooling agent; a condenser for condensing said cooling agent; a decompressor for decompressing said cooling agent condensed by said condenser; an evaporator for evaporating said cooling agent decompressed by said decompressor; a cooling portion for cooling said charger with use of said cooling agent flowing from said condenser, said cooling portion being provided on a path of the said cooling agent flowing from said condenser to said decompressor; and a communication passage for allowing communication between a path of said cooling agent flowing from said cooling portion to said decompressor and a path of said cooling agent flowing from said compressor to said condenser said cooling portion being arranged below said condenser. |
